嵌入式开发者社区

标题: UART设置奇偶校验出现的问题 [打印本页]

作者: HRJ    时间: 2021-7-12 21:22
标题: UART设置奇偶校验出现的问题
设置UART2的奇偶校验位,发送字符串给PC,使用串口助手查看发送的字符串。出现了如图所示的问题,请问这种问题该如何解决呢?(PS: 采用轮询和中断的demo均会出现这样的问题)

作者: HRJ    时间: 2021-7-13 11:24
用户手册中的LCR寄存器那里是不是写错了?如图所示

作者: JSZC    时间: 2021-7-15 15:10
1、这边看您这样修改应该是没有问题的,前面是发的什么字符串,后面看Tronlong是打印正常的;
2、您反馈的“用户手册中的LCR寄存器是否描述错误”具体是哪一份文档呢,这边核对一下;

3、麻烦您确认后将问题发到我司技术邮箱support@tronlong.com,这边通过邮箱给您跟进。

作者: HRJ    时间: 2021-7-15 16:16
JSZC 发表于 2021-7-15 15:10
1、这边看您这样修改应该是没有问题的,前面是发的什么字符串,后面看Tronlong是打印正常的;
2、您反馈的 ...

1、Tronlong前面串口助手接收到的字符是?(问号),转成16进制后就是3F,说明并不是乱码,确实是串口发过来的,但是发送的字符串数组里面并不包含'?'这个字符。
2、我看的是TMS320C6748 DSP Technical Reference Manual (Rev. C)中关于UART部分的内容(LCR寄存器那边)。翻译的和原文是一致的,可能是ti写错了吧。。






欢迎光临 嵌入式开发者社区 (https://www.51ele.net/) Powered by Discuz! X3.4